The New Orleans Pelicans selected Jaron Pierre Jr. from Southern Methodist University with the 58th overall pick in the 2026 NBA Draft. Pierre Jr. is a hometown product, originally from New Orleans and having attended St. Augustine High School.
The 6'5" shooting guard brings a compelling scoring arsenal, highlighted by athletic finishes and an improved three-point shot, making 37.7% on seven attempts per game over the last two seasons. His ability to create his own shot and knock down contested threes is notable.
However, questions linger regarding his defensive consistency and playmaking abilities, as evidenced by his assist-to-turnover ratio. Pierre Jr. will need to demonstrate improvement in these areas, along with his defensive impact, to secure a rotation spot with the Pelicans.
Pierre Jr. is expected to compete for a roster spot during the Summer League and preseason. His potential addition could bolster the Pelicans' shooting and depth at shooting guard, especially if other players depart.
